CC   -!- FUNCTION: Involved in the gluconeogenesis. Catalyzes stereospecifically
CC       the conversion of dihydroxyacetone phosphate (DHAP) to D-
CC       glyceraldehyde-3-phosphate (G3P). {ECO:0000255|HAMAP-Rule:MF_00147}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=D-glyceraldehyde 3-phosphate = dihydroxyacetone phosphate;
CC         Xref=Rhea:RHEA:18585, ChEBI:CHEBI:57642, ChEBI:CHEBI:59776;
CC         EC=5.3.1.1; Evidence={ECO:0000255|HAMAP-Rule:MF_00147};
CC   -!- PATHWAY: Carbohydrate biosynthesis; gluconeogenesis.
CC       {ECO:0000255|HAMAP-Rule:MF_00147}.
CC   -!- PATHWAY: Carbohydrate degradation; glycolysis; D-glyceraldehyde 3-
CC       phosphate from glycerone phosphate: step 1/1. {ECO:0000255|HAMAP-
CC       Rule:MF_00147}.
CC   -!- SUBUNIT: Homodimer. {ECO:0000255|HAMAP-Rule:MF_00147}.
CC   -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000255|HAMAP-Rule:MF_00147}.
CC   -!- SIMILARITY: Belongs to the triosephosphate isomerase family.
CC       {ECO:0000255|HAMAP-Rule:MF_00147}.
